THESSALY, Pharsalos. Late 5th-mid 4th century BC. AR Drachm (19mm, 6.11 g, 7h). Helmeted head of Athena left; TH to left / Φ-A-P-Σ (partially retrograde), Thessalian cavalryman on horse rearing right, holding goad; TH below; all within incuse square. Lavva 101a (V50/R57 – this coin, illustrated); BCD Thessaly II 639 var. (no TH on rev.); HGC 4, 624. Near EF, toned, test cut and banker’s mark on obverse.


From the BCD Collection. Ex Norman Davis Collection (Numismatic Fine Arts XI, 8 December 1982), lot 109; Hess (7 March 1935), lot 331.
